Crushed limestone concrete also has a lower thermal coefficient of expansion than gravel concrete. This means that slabs poured with limestone concrete will expand and contract less than gravel concrete for a given change in temperature. Step 1: extraction of raw materials The raw materials needed to produce cement (calcium carbonate, silica, alumina and iron ore) are generally extracted from limestone rock, chalk, clayey schist or clay.

Cemex operates a limestone quarry near Wampum, Pennsylvania, that supplies the feed to their nearby cement factory. The quarry had traditionally been mined using surface methods, but while extracting the Vanport Limestone, the mining ratio began to increase.
